Company overview

PDF Solutions, Inc. offers a comprehensive array of solutions to the semiconductor sector, encompassing proprietary software, physical intellectual property for integrated circuit designs, electrical measurement hardware, proven methodologies, and professional services. The company maintains a global presence, with significant operations in the United States, China, Japan, Taiwan, and other international regions. At the core of their software portfolio is the Exensio platform. This includes Manufacturing Analytics, which centralizes collected data, providing engineers with a consistent view to effectively identify and analyze production yield, performance, and reliability issues. Process Control delivers capabilities for failure detection, classification, and robust monitoring and management of manufacturing tool sets. Test Operations focuses on efficient data collection and analytical functionalities, while Assembly Operations is designed to seamlessly link assembly, packaging, fabrication, and characterization data throughout a product's entire lifespan. Beyond software, PDF Solutions provides advanced hardware and systems such as their design-for-inspection (DFI) Systems, featuring DFI on-chip instruments, and the eProbe, a non-contact E-beam tool. They also offer the Characterization Vehicle (CV) system, which comprises CV test chips, pdFasTest electrical testers, and specialized Exensio characterization software tailored to process measurements gathered from DFI on-chip instruments using the eProbe tool. Further enhancing their product suite are Cimetrix software products, which facilitate the implementation of industry-standard interfaces for equipment manufacturers. Their service offerings extend to software-as-a-service (SaaS) subscriptions, various software-related support, and dedicated characterization services. PDF Solutions engages a broad spectrum of clients—including integrated device manufacturers, fabless semiconductor companies, foundries, equipment manufacturers, electronics manufacturing suppliers, original device manufacturers, outsourced semiconductor assembly and test firms, and system houses—through a combination of direct sales, dedicated service teams, and strategic alliances. Established in 1991, the company's headquarters are located in Santa Clara, California.
